Closed Bug 648330 Opened 13 years ago Closed 13 years ago

Remove First Run page for Aurora Channel

Categories

(Firefox :: General, defect)

defect
Not set
major

Tracking

()

VERIFIED FIXED
Firefox 5

People

(Reporter: lmesa, Assigned: Gavin)

References

Details

(Whiteboard: [bugday-20110513])

We're trying to ascertain if there is a first run page for the aurora channel as it stands.  If there is, we'd like to remove it. If we can't remove it for this release, we'd like to remove/disable for subsequent releases.
Blocks: 648332
This could be implemented by the update snippet itself via bug 459972 but I doubt that bug will be fixed anytime soon so it might be better to do this in the browser for now.
(In reply to comment #1)
> This could be implemented by the update snippet itself via bug 459972 but I
> doubt that bug will be fixed anytime soon so it might be better to do this in
> the browser for now.

Sorry--Rob, not sure if your comment means that we can remove the first run page, but through the browser as opposed to through bug 459972 or if its not possible to remove it at all. Can you clarify?
The first run page is part of browser and not app update so I am not really the one to make the call but I believe it can be one-off'd via nsBrowserContentHandler.js. Gavin would be able to answer this better than I can.
Status: NEW → ASSIGNED
Status: ASSIGNED → NEW
Gavin--

Can you tell us if this is possible? We need to know soon in order for us to take care of creating a first run page tomorrow if not.
Assignee: nobody → gavin.sharp
Severity: normal → major
Sure, removing it based on the update channel is doable. We'll need to coordinate with releng to make sure we use the right build time channel name.
Actually, we can just do this by modifying the branding (an empty pref will result in no firstrun/whatsnew pages opening).
Depends on: 648368
The Aurora branding currently does not include any firstrun or whatsnew pages - that can be revisited at later date.
Status: NEW → RESOLVED
Closed: 13 years ago
Flags: in-testsuite-
OS: Mac OS X → All
Hardware: x86 → All
Resolution: --- → FIXED
Target Milestone: --- → Firefox4.2
Target Milestone: Firefox5 → Firefox 5
Verified on Mozilla/5.0 (Macintosh; Intel Mac OS X 10.6; rv:5.0a2) Gecko/20110513 Firefox/5.0a2
Status: RESOLVED → VERIFIED
Whiteboard: [bugday-20110513]
You need to log in before you can comment on or make changes to this bug.